Job Description
We are seeking an experienced Tool & Process lead to oversee the entire product life cycle management process, including new product development. You will define process capabilities and tools strategy through strategic partnerships with businesses and work with process and tools teams to deliver the roadmap. You will work in hybrid model with office in Katowice. You will report directly to the Director, Business Process and Tools.
Your Responsibilities:
- Define process capabilities and tools strategy through strategic partnerships with businesses.
- Capture and synthesize inputs and needs, select the best solutions to meet those needs, and facilitate alignment to high-impact priorities.
- Build an execution plan to manage transformation and drive stakeholder alignment to implement and integrate solutions.
- Evolve process improvements with key metrics to drive transformation.
The Essentials - You Will Have:
- Experience in managing large-scale transformation projects.
- Bachelor's degree in engineering, Computer Science, or a related field.
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in a similar role..
- Strong project management skills with a track record of successful project delivery.
- Proficiency in tools integration, including Jama, Jira, Windchill, SAP, and Jira Align.
The Preferred - You Might Also Have:
- Master's degree in engineering, Computer Science, or a related field.
- Certification in project management (e.g., PMP, PRINCE2).
- Experience with cloud-based tools and platforms.
- Familiarity with data analytics and reporting tools.
- Experience leading cross-functional teams and drive consensus.
- Knowledge of cybersecurity regulations such as IEC62443 and SOC2
- Understanding of development methodologies like waterfall and agile
